Ukraine does not plan to extend current grain export quotas after July 1, Minister of Agrarian Policy Mykola Prysyazhnyuk said on Wednesday. Last year's draught hit Ukraine's grain crop hard, and the government had to limit exports of wheat to 1 million tons, corn to 3 million tons and barley to 200,000 tons. Read more.
